Lipid peroxidation effects of trichloroethylene on occupationally exposed wokers

  •   Objective   To evaluate the lipid peroxidation effects of trichloroethylene(TCE)on occupationally exposed individuals.
      Methods   207 pieces of shif-tending urine and blood from occupationaly exposed workers were collected.To analyse the level of urine Trichloroactic acid(TCA)and lipid peroxidation in peripheral blood such as the activity or concentr ation of calalase(CAT)superoxide dismutase(SOD)glutathione peroxidase(GSH-PX)and malondialdehyde(MDA)in various dosed groups.
      Results   The activity of erythrocyte CAT, total serum SOD and GSH-PX or the concetration of serum MDA significantly increased compared with the controls.CAT, total SOD was assumed to have parbaolical correlation with the exposure time, CAT, total SOD and GSH-PX had the same corelation with urine TCA concentration.MDA had significant linear correlation with the exposure time or urine TCA concentration.
      Conclusion   TCE can stimulate lipid peroxisome proliferation.The lipid peroxidation level of the peripherl blood may be one of the early biomarkers of TCE exposure.CAT may be applied as one of the early and secsitive bio-effect indexs.
